Foundation stabilizing services involve specialized techniques designed to address issues related to the stability and integ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ically include methods such as under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ization, which aim to reinforce the foundation and prevent further movement or settlement. Professionals assess the specific conditions of a property to determine the most effective stabilization approach, ensuring that the structural support is restored or maintained. The goal is to create a more stable base for the building, reducing the risk of damage caused by shifting or sinking foundations.

These services help resolve common problems associated with foundation movement, such as cracks in walls and floors, uneven flooring, or doors and windows that no longer close properly. Foundation instability can lead to significant structural issues if left unaddressed, potentially resulting in costly repairs or safety concerns. Stabilization techniques are designed to mitigate these issues by providing additional support beneath or around the foundation, thereby preventing further deterioration and protecting the overall integrity of the property.

Properties that typically utilize foundation stabilizing services include residential homes, especially those built on expansive or shifting soils. Commercial buildings, multi-unit dwellings, and historical structures may also require stabilization to maintain safety and functionality. These services are particularly relevant in areas prone to so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or where previous settling has caused noticeable structural concerns. Regardless of property type, proper stabilization can help prolong the lifespan of the structure and maintain its value.

The overview below groups typical Foundation Stabilizing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Mequon, WI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Foundation Stabilizing Cost - Typical expenses for foundation stabilization range from $3,000 to $15,000 depending on the extent of the work. For example, minor repairs may cost around $3,500, while more extensive stabilization can reach $12,000 or more.

Type of Stabilization - Costs vary based on the stabilization method used, such as underpinning or piering. Piering services in Mequon often fall between $4,000 and $10,000 for standard projects.

Size of the Property - Larger or multi-story homes generally require more materials and labor, which can increase costs to $8,000-$20,000. Smaller homes might see stabilization costs closer to $4,000-$8,000.

Accessibility and Conditions - Difficult site conditions or limited access can add to the overall cost, potentially increasing expenses by a few thousand dollars. Local pros evaluate these factors during project estimates.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are foundation stabilizing services? Foundation stabilizing services involve techniques used to reinforce and support a building’s foundation to prevent or repair settling, shifting, or cracking issues.

How do foundation stabilization methods work? These methods typically include installing underpinning, piers, or braces to improve the stability and load-bearing capacity of the foundation.

What signs indicate the need for foundation stabilization? Signs may include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, doors or windows that stick, or noticeable settling of the structure.

Are foundation stabilization services suitable for all types of foundations? These services can be adapted for various foundation types, including concrete slabs, basements, and crawl spaces, depending on the specific issues.
